Output 80de6bef6f7cd7d251658db702a9f2628838e0103f1751235c783441705fa229:1

value
39331102
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a428030219b2bd72adc3a5cc3e8cbce9048b8c6 OP_EQUALVERIFY OP_CHECKSIG
address
1PpFbWZRC7XKFuSLQBCoABaMJbN6YHGmAz
transaction
80de6bef6f7cd7d251658db702a9f2628838e0103f1751235c783441705fa229
spent
true